Man quizzed on rapes

A FORMER Doveton resident has been questioned by police in relation to a number of rapes dating back more than 15 years.
Detective Sergeant Garry Kear of Narre Warren CIU said the 47-year-old had been interviewed at the Northcote Police Station last week in relation to allegations of rape and false imprisonment. The incidents are alleged to have occurred between 1989 and 1991 in Doveton.
Det Sgt Kear said the man in question had been a known friend of Brian Keith Jones, known as Mr Baldy, and had served time in prison.
He said the allegations had been made by the man’s former wife and police would not need to canvass witnesses dating back to that time.
